What is the table’s resistance to UV rays, and how does it prevent color fading?
When investing in outdoor or sun-exposed indoor furniture, a critical question arises: What is the table’s resistance to UV rays, and how does it prevent color fading? Ultraviolet radiation from the sun is a primary agent of photodegradation, breaking down chemical bonds in dyes, wood finishes, and plastics, leading to the dull, washed-out appearance we know as fading. A table with high UV resistance is specifically engineered to combat this relentless assault.
This protection is achieved through several sophisticated methods. Firstly, the inherent material composition is key. Certain plastics, like acrylic (PMMA) and high-density polyethylene (HDPE), possess molecular structures that are naturally more resilient to UV wavelengths. For materials like wood and metal, the defense lies in the finish. High-quality tables are coated with UV-inhibiting sealants, lacquers, or paints. These coatings often contain additives such as UV absorbers, which act like sunscreen, soaking up the harmful rays before they penetrate the surface. Furthermore, light stabilizers, particularly Hindered Amine Light Stabilizers (HALS), are integrated into materials and coatings. HALS work by neutralizing the free radicals generated by UV exposure, interrupting the chain reaction of degradation that causes color molecules to break down.
The physical construction also contributes to longevity. Powder coatings on metal tables, for instance, are typically more UV-stable and thicker than liquid paint, creating a robust, monolithic barrier. For glass table tops, a tinted or laminated glass with a protective UV-filtering interlayer can block over 99% of harmful rays. The result of these integrated technologies is a table that maintains its aesthetic integrity, structural strength, and vibrant color for years, effectively preventing the unsightly and irreversible damage of color fading caused by prolonged sun exposure.
